Keegan-Michael Key and Jordan Peele are comedians popular for their hit series "Key and Peele" on Comedy Central. What makes them unique is both comedians are bi-racial with white and black parents giving them full range to make fun of two of the three major races in the U.S.
This is their most popular skit, hands down, which pokes fun at football players' names. The last three names had me in tears laughing!
